On Mon, May 09, 2016 at 05:55:03 -0400, Ericbarnhill wrote:
> I would like to resolve an old Apache commons-math JIRA ticket
> (https://issues.apache.org/jira/browse/MATH-667) regarding the
> behavior of Complex objects in commons-math. In particular I think it
> would be nice to resolve it by synchronizing Complex[] behavior to
> Octave complex numbers (with an eye toward creating a bridge between
> them later). A couple of initial questions:
>
> -- does Octave follow the C99 standard or some other?
Octave Complex types are exactly std::complex<T>. If you are compiling
with a C++11-conforming compiler, then they are binary compatible with
C99 _Complex types, but I don't think any API compatibility is provided.
> -- is all the relevant behavior contained in
> libinterp/octave-value/ov-complex.cc ?
I don't know what all the relevant behavior is. That file defines some
operations on Octave complex types.
